The Snowflake Trade

The ARKK and ARKW ETFs purchased a total of 223,690 Snowflake shares, valued at approximately $52 million, based on Snowflake’s closing price of $232.29.

Snowflake reported first-quarter fiscal 2027 results that exceeded expectations, with revenue rising 33% year-over-year to $1.39 billion and adjusted earnings of 39 cents per share. Product revenue increased 34% to $1.33 billion, while remaining performance obligations grew 38% to $9.21 billion, reflecting continued demand for the company’s AI-focused data cloud platform.
